Summary Summary of gene provided in NCBI Entrez Gene.
This gene encodes a member of the frizzled-related protein family. The encoded protein plays an important role in eye development and mutations in this gene have been associated with nanophthalmos, posterior microphthalmia, retinitis pigmentosa, foveoschi

Tissue specificity TISSUE SPECIFICITY: Specifically expressed in brain. Strongly expressed in medulla oblongata and to a lower extent in hippocampus and corpus callosum. Expressed in keratinocytes. {ECO:0000269|PubMed:11263980, ECO:0000269|PubMed:16442268}.
